To make the pastry, sift the flour into a bowl and season well. Warm the milk, water and lard until the lard has melted. Bring just to the boil and pour onto the flour mix, stir well, then add the egg and mix again. Turn onto a floured surface and knead for 3-4 mins. Webb5 sep. 2024 · Process the flour and butter in a food processor until the mixture resembles fine breadcrumbs. While the motor is running, add enough iced water to form a smooth dough. Knead very lightly then wrap the dough in plastic wrap and refrigerate for 30 minutes. When ready to use, roll out on a lightly floured surface until 3mm (1/8 in) thick. Webb9 apr. 2024 · Cream butter and sugar just until combined and slightly aerated. Add the egg and vanilla, mix to combine and scrape down the bowl and beater. Add flour and salt and mix until the dough just begins to come together. Remove from the mixer and knead into a ball. Flatten the ball to a disc, wrap in plastic and refrigerate for 1-2 hours before using.
